Why Georgetown Homes Need a Proper Floor Coating
Georgetown summers hit 95-100°F regularly and garage interiors reach 120 to 130°F by July afternoon — the same hot-tire-lift conditions as the rest of the metro. But Georgetown has a second factor most Austin suburbs don’t: a large population of retirees in the Sun City community where slip resistance and ease of cleaning matter more than they do in a younger demographic. Our coating system gives both: the polyaspartic topcoat ignores heat, and we routinely broadcast aluminum oxide aggregate into the topcoat for slip resistance in Sun City and other older-resident installs. The slab conditions vary too — older downtown homes may need crack repair, Sun City homes are usually clean candidates for one-day polyaspartic.
What We Typically Find in Georgetown Garages
- Historic downtown (1800s-1920s): usually no attached garage on the original home; detached garages added later, often pre-1980 with rough slabs that need significant prep — sometimes microtopping resurfacing before coating
- Established 1980s-1990s neighborhoods near Southwestern University: two-bay attached garages with mid-life wear; common candidates for the two-day full build with light repair
- Sun City (2000s+): single-bay or two-bay attached garages on tight master-planned lots; clean slabs; one-day polyaspartic installs are common, often with aluminum oxide aggregate for slip resistance
- Western Georgetown (2010s+): newer master-planned subdivisions on the Hill Country edge; clean current-spec slabs ready for one-day polyaspartic

My home is historic downtown — do I need a permit to coat my garage?
For owner-occupied residential garages in Georgetown, no permit is required for a floor coating. If your home is in the historic district and you’re making other exterior changes, those may require historic-district review — but a floor coating inside the garage is not a regulated improvement.
Is the floor slippery for an older resident?
By default the embedded flake gives the floor a textured grip. For Sun City installs we routinely broadcast aluminum oxide aggregate into the topcoat for extra slip resistance — the aggregate doesn’t change the visual finish noticeably but it hits ASTM F1679 wet-surface friction values that exceed safety standards.

What We Typically See in 78628
Georgetown’s 78628 zip code is the most architecturally varied in the Austin metro. The historic district downtown has houses from the 1880s through the 1920s, some of which had detached garages added later (often poorly poured pre-1980 slabs that need significant prep). The middle-aged neighborhoods near Southwestern University and along Williams Drive are 1980s-1990s standard suburban construction with normal mid-life wear. Sun City, on the western edge, is a 2000s+ master-planned retirement community with tight modern slabs. And the newest developments along the western Hill Country edge are 2015+ master-planned communities with current-spec construction. The unifying factor across all four is the climate, and the polyaspartic topcoat handles all four. The variable is the prep, which is why every Georgetown estimate involves a detailed slab inspection rather than a phone quote.
